Since the introduction of digital video DV technology, the technique of production have turn into extra democratized. Filmmakers can conceivably shoot a movie with a digital video camera and edit the film, create and edit the sound and music, and blend the final minimize on a high-end home computer. However, whereas the technique of production may be democratized, financing, distribution, and advertising remain troublesome to perform outside the traditional system.

A preview performance refers to a showing of a film to a select audience, often for the purposes of company promotions, earlier than the public film premiere itself. Previews are sometimes used to gauge viewers response, which if unexpectedly negative, may lead to recutting or even refilming sure sections primarily based on the viewers response. One example of a movie that was changed after a negative response from the check screening is 1982's First Blood. After the check viewers responded very negatively to the demise of protagonist John Rambo, a Vietnam veteran, at the end of the film, the company wrote and re-shot a model new ending during which the character survives.

A "feature-length movie", or "characteristic movie", is of a conventional full length, normally 60 minutes or extra, and might commercially stand by itself with out different movies in a ticketed screening. A "brief" is a movie that is not so lengthy as a feature-length film, often screened with other shorts, or preceding a feature-length movie. Because animation is very time-consuming and infrequently very expensive to produce, the majority of animation for TV and films comes from skilled animation studios. However, the sector of independent animation has existed at least because the Nineteen Fifties, with animation being produced by independent studios . Several impartial animation producers have gone on to enter the skilled animation industry.
